Output ec1a83923d3c8387eae9c927ae73cc8d89da255f27160f61aa9276b4bddf170a:15

value
28589130
script pubkey
OP_0 OP_PUSHBYTES_20 af946bd6c0ab80c075fdf2ca1ebd037d9edccbe3
address
bc1q472xh4kq4wqvqa0a7t9pa0gr0k0dejlr2j2qfw
transaction
ec1a83923d3c8387eae9c927ae73cc8d89da255f27160f61aa9276b4bddf170a
spent
true